XML::LibXML =========== This module implements much of the DOM Level 2 API as an interface to the Gnome libxml2 library. This makes it a fast and highly capable validating XML parser library, as well as a high performance DOM. IMPORTANT NOTE ============== XML::LibXML was almost entirely reimplemented between version 1.40 to version 1.49. This may cause problems on some production machines. with version 1.50 a lot of compatibility fixes were applied, so programs written for XML::LibXML 1.40 or less should run with version 1.50 again. Installation ============ Prior to installation you MUST have installed the libxml2 library. You can get the latest libxml2 version from http://xmlsoft.org Then run: $ perl Makefile.PL $ make test $ su $ make install Parser documentation is in perldoc XML::LibXML. DOM documentation starts in perldoc XML::LibXML::Document and perldoc XML::LibXML::Node. If your libxml2 installation is not within your $PATH. you can set the environment variable XMLPREFIX=$YOURLIBXMLPREFIX to make XML::LibXML recognize the correct libxml2 version in use. e.g. $ XMLPREFIX=/usr/brand-new perl Makefile.PL will ask '/usr/brand-new/bin/xml2-config' about your real libxml2 configuration. NOTES FOR HPUX ============== XML::LibXML requires libxml2 2.4.20 or later. That means the current binary libxml2 package for HPUX cannot be used with XML::LibXML. For some reasons the HPUX cc will not compile libxml2 correct, which will force you to recompile perl with gcc (if you havn't already done that).
